Just set up postfix & it's running on my RHES 4.2 box.

Immediately after postfix is up, I test sending emails from a permitted
domain
(ahhh, on this postfix server's domain firewall, we even have a firewall
rule
 which permits Tcp25 from those few sending domains' SMTP servers) using
an email client  to sender_id@[IP_address_of_the_postfix_server]  & the
/var/log/maillog on the postfix server indicated the email arrives at the
postfix
server (with some errors though) :

# grep recipient_id /var/log/maillog*
maillog:Feb 15 11:41:52 hostname postfix/smtpd[6891]: NOQUEUE: reject: RCPT
from gate1.mds.com.sg[203.126.130.157]: 554 5.7.1
<recipient_id@[202.6.163.31]>:
Relay access denied; from=<prvs=020cae8c4=recipient_id at mds.com.sg>
to=<recipient_id@[202.6.163.31]> proto=ESMTP helo=<gate1.mds.com.sg>
maillog:Feb 15 13:43:20 hostname sendmail[7688]: NOQUEUE:
SYSERR(recipient_id): can not chdir(/var/spool/mqueue/): Permission denied

Then I installed dovecot rpm on my RHES box : uninstall it as it's an old
version &
reinstall with a newer version & start up dovecot as well.

I did not test sending to sender_id at domain_name at that time because the
domain I purchased from a domain provider/registrar has yet to be registered
in our ISP's DNS.  Subsequently I registered the following A, MX & NS
 records with our ISP :

A: myportaltech.com. IN A 202.6.163.31
A: smtp.myportaltech.com. IN A 202.6.163.31

PTR: 31.163.6.202.in-addr.arpa. IN PTR smtp.myportaltech.com.

MX: myportaltech.com. IN MX 10 smtp.myportaltech.com.

NS: myportaltech.com.        IN     NS     ns1.businessexprezz.com.
NS: myportaltech.com.        IN     NS     ns2.businessexprezz.com.

The above myportaltech is just a fictitious name of my domain but I
can provide the actual domain name if needed.

After the above records have been propagated to all other DNSes, I
test sending email from the same permitted domain, this time using
domain name & the email never arrives & I did not receive a 'bounced
mail' notification too.  Then I test sending from the same domain to
recipient_id@[202.6.163.31] & this time round, the test email never
show up in /var/log/maillog* anymore.

The network/security guys confirmed that the firewall logs did not
show any denied SMTP records.

So how do I go about troubleshooting this?

Is this a DNS record entries issue, firewall/network issue, related to
dovecot or something within my postfix server?
